Pennsylvania SR104 recognizes May 2025 as "National Mammography Month" in Pennsylvania. The resolution highlights the importance of mammograms in early breast cancer detection, emphasizing that they can reduce breast cancer deaths by 22%. It notes that many women diagnosed with breast cancer have no family history of the disease and that early detection is critical, with a 99% survival rate for localized stage breast cancer. The resolution encourages Pennsylvania residents, especially those in high-risk groups, to schedule a mammography appointment.
